    Why AI Firms Should Embrace a Quantum-Like Research Approach

    Artificial intelligence (AI) and quantum computing often dominate technology discussions. They promise to reshape industries and daily life. However, they follow different paths in their development and presentation.

    Quantum computing remains largely experimental. Recent advances have delivered prototypes, yet they still struggle with basic utility. In contrast, AI quickly penetrated global markets. Companies integrate AI into numerous applications, often without revealing how these systems function. This trend raises questions about transparency.

    Moreover, quantum computing researchers regularly publish peer-reviewed studies. They remain tethered to scientific principles while engaging the marketplace. This method fosters credibility. It builds trust within the scientific community and among potential users. AI firms, however, increasingly prioritize profits over openness. They seldom share foundational research. Instead, they offer subscription models without detailing their workings.

    For AI firms, adopting a more quantum-like approach could yield benefits. First, enhancing transparency might alleviate public skepticism. Researchers believe that when companies openly share methodologies, users feel empowered and informed. This shift could cultivate a more informed user base.

    Furthermore, a focus on practical applications will drive innovation. AI firms should identify real-world challenges and address them clearly. By doing so, they can align their technologies with society’s needs.

    Next, collaboration between academia and industry can be fruitful. Just as quantum researchers forge partnerships to advance knowledge, AI firms should do the same. These collaborations can spark breakthroughs and lead to significant advancements.

    Ultimately, adopting a research-driven mentality will enhance AI’s credibility. It may also reinvigorate the excitement surrounding its capabilities. Public trust can arise when firms commit to transparency.

    AI has already changed our world. However, will it fulfill its promise without an emphasis on rigorous research? By imitating quantum computing’s transparency, AI companies can navigate this challenge. In doing so, they ensure that their technology is not just revolutionary, but also trustworthy.
